The Subtle Science of Ayahuasca: Potential Impacts on Neurotransmitters

Ayahuasca, a powerful brew indigenous to the Amazon basin, has attracted increasing attention for its potential therapeutic effects. Traditionally used in spiritual and healing ceremonies, ayahuasca contains copyright, a copyright compound that alters neurotransmission in the brain. Research suggests that copyright may interact with serotonin receptors, leading to profound changes in perception, cognition, and emotion.

Furthermore, ayahuasca also contains MAO inhibitors, which block enzymes that break down copyright, prolonging its effects. This complex interplay of compounds may contribute to the unique experiences reported by ayahuasca users, including feelings of euphoria, introspection, and mystical insights. While the exact mechanisms underlying these effects remain unclear, ongoing studies are shedding light on the potential impact of ayahuasca on neurotransmitters and its implications for mental health.

Unveiling the Therapeutic Benefits and Risks of Ayahuasca

Ayahuasca, a potent brew prepared from Amazonian plants, has experienced widespread popularity for its potential therapeutic benefits. Users seeking to manage conditions like trauma often turn to ayahuasca sessions, believing it can facilitate profound spiritual and emotional discoveries. However, the potent nature of ayahuasca also presents inherent risks. Potential negative responses can range from mild nausea and troubling to more serious psychological disturbances.

It is crucial to approach ayahuasca with caution, conducting thorough investigation and seeking guidance from experienced healers. Fundamentally, a balanced understanding that weighs both the potential advantages and risks is necessary for making informed decisions regarding ayahuasca use.
